Mah Jongg is a wonderful game that promotes brain health in several ways! It provides an opportunity to stay social by engaging with friends on a regular basis. It is also very challenging and keeps my mind sharp. I love learning new strategies and stumping myself when the tiles simply don't match a hand on the card!
Today, an estimated 50 million people worldwide are living with Alzheimer's or other dementias, including more than 6 million Americans. In the United States alone, more than 11 million friends and family members are providing their care. We must take action now, or these numbers will continue to rise.
